Whiskey Flash Blog: Sampling Kentucky 10 Year Old Bourbon 100 Proof – “Rebel Rebel, I Love You So!”

October 12, 2022 by Gary Leave a Comment

Kentucky 10 Year Old Single Barrel Bourbon 100 Proof Whiskey!

Welcome to the #RebelBourbon #Whiskey #FlashBlog!

Organised by Steve from The Whisky Wire numerous contributors will be posting articles today sharing their sampling thoughts on the recently released Kentucky 10 Year Old Single Barrel Bourbon 100 Proof Whiskey.

If you would like to see what everyone thought search for the hash tag #RebelBourbon on Twitter!

A bourbon that is one-of-a-kind, just like the rebels who drink it!

So, here goes …

Kentucky-based Lux Row Distillers have released this special bourbon which has been distilled and aged in Bardstown, Kentucky, USA.

A Multi-award winning Whiskey, distillery notes say it “initially has hints of caramel and citrus but continue sipping and it morphs into a velvety oak flavour with unabashed spice.”

Aged in charred oak barrels for 10 years, this bourbon boasts a unique flavour profile specific to each batch. It’s one-of-a-kind, just like the rebels who drink it!

So, what did I think? Here are my tasting notes …

Tasting Notes – Kentucky 10 Year Old Single Barrel Bourbon 100 Proof Whiskey (50%)

Nose: An orchard extravaganza! Lots of crisp fresh apples, sweet toffee and banana.

Palate: Oaky with a little dryness. Toffee, lemon citrus, seville oranges and a little chocolate.

Finish: Deep and warming spice that grows with each sip topped with sharp pepper.

Overall: A very tasty dram indeed with plenty going on – I’m not surprised it has been a multi-award winner!

ABOUT LUX ROW DISTILLERS

Real roots, real family, real products: Lux Row Distillers – a bourbon distillery experience on the Kentucky Bourbon Trail –brings the Lux family history and spirits tradition to the bourbon industry.

Lux Row Distillers is the home of bourbon brands including Rebel, Blood Oath, David Nicholson, Daviess County and Ezra Brooks.

Located in the heart of Bardstown, Kentucky, the 18,000-square foot Lux Row Distillers site includes a visitor centre, barrel warehouses, a tasting room, and event space, making for an all-encompassing bourbon experience. The 90-acre property is home to an 18th century stone house, registered as a National Historic Place, and a long, tree-lined driveway providing a scenic entrance to the distillery.
